The Asteroid City actress revealed what she really thought of a controversial joke that husband Colin Jost made about her during a joke swap with his Weekend Update cohost Michael Che on Saturday Night Live in December.
“I just can’t believe that they went there,” Scarlett told InStyle in an interview published March 11. “It was so vulgar. It was so gross. It was really gross. And, like, old-school gross.”
E! News has reached out to SNL for comment and hasn’t heard back.
During the exchange, Colin said, “Costco has removed the roast beef sandwich from its menu. But I ain’t trippin’. I’ve been eating roast beef every night since my wife had the kid,” before the camera cut to Scarlett backstage at SNL, where she mouthed, “Oh my God.”
“No, no, I’m just playin’, baby,” her husband continued. “You know I don’t go downtown.”
The camera cut back to the Black Widow actress—mom to son Cosmo, 3, with Colin and daughter Rose, 10, with Romain Dauriac—who audibly gasped in response. And, while she was given a heads up that Michael had written a “vagina joke” about her, she didn’t expect it to go so far.
